Output 21db54e1ec91abb3c0062027cde65c5211db9900a6193ee8d5da2df7a1c7bb17:0

value
60000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f689cc95e70e9155500229560017869e797f6e42 OP_EQUALVERIFY OP_CHECKSIG
address
1PUaJeMC9ep1BZVW9tzhQUYkDkmRG9Q5qJ
transaction
21db54e1ec91abb3c0062027cde65c5211db9900a6193ee8d5da2df7a1c7bb17
confirmations
308671
spent
true